Good Gosh O Mighty! That dern Flying Lure commercial had every fisherman I know hypnotized for years, they kept playing it over n over....prob about 1990.
I fell for it and bought some,
its a jig head and hook along with a flat short plastic
that falls AWAY from you instead of towards you,
The gimmick on tv was that you go up to a tree and as you cast to the trunk that flying lure glided away from you instead of falling straight down or towards you.
The advantage you ask? Supposedly if you could sight fish and spot the bass, the lure could be presented with a constant motion of going to its face just by the angler raising and dropping his rodtip.
And of course it had about a dozen testimonials
of people swearing by them.
It was the dawn of the infomercial and everyone
I know tried them on panfish and bass.
I guess they work, its a novelty at best in my book.
